23 Madoc Street, Llandudno, LL30 2TL
Commercial, Retail
Unit 23, Victoria Centre, Llandudno, LL30 2RH
Commercial, Retail
Unit 24, Victoria Centre, Llandudno, LL30 2RH
Commercial, Retail